Mistral Workflows

Build reliable, production-grade AI workflows with Python.

Overview

Mistral Workflows is a Python SDK for building AI-powered workflows with built-in reliability, observability, and scalability. It provides fault tolerance, durability, and exactly-once execution guarantees.

Features

  • Simple Python API: Define workflows using Python decorators
  • Built-in Reliability: Automatic retries, timeouts, and error handling
  • Distributed Execution: Scale workflows across multiple workers
  • LLM Integration: Native support for Mistral AI and other LLM providers
  • Observability: Distributed tracing, structured logging, and event streaming
  • Type Safety: Full type hints and Pydantic validation

Installation

pip install mistralai-workflows

Quick Start

from datetime import timedelta

from mistralai.workflows import workflow, activity

@activity
async def get_weather(city: str) -> str:
    # Your activity implementation
    return f"Weather in {city}: Sunny"

@workflow.define
class WeatherWorkflow:
    @workflow.run
    async def run(self, city: str) -> str:
        weather = await workflow.execute_activity(
            get_weather,
            city,
            start_to_close_timeout=timedelta(seconds=10),
        )
        return weather

Examples

The SDK includes comprehensive examples in the mistralai/workflows/examples directory. You can run all examples with a single command:

# Run all example workflows in a single worker
python -m mistralai.workflows.examples.all_workflows_worker
